Market Sizing, Growth Estimates, and CAGR Projections

Based on current industry data, the South Korea abrasive waterjet cutting machine market was valued at approximately USD 150 million in 2023. Driven by manufacturing sector expansion, technological adoption, and increasing demand for precision cutting, the market is projected to grow at a compound annual growth rate (CAGR) of 7.5% over the next five years, reaching an estimated USD 220 million by 2028.

Assumptions underpinning these estimates include:

  • Continued industrial automation and adoption of high-precision manufacturing techniques.
  • Government incentives for advanced manufacturing and export-oriented industries.
  • Growing demand from aerospace, automotive, and electronics sectors for complex, high-quality cuts.
  • Incremental technological improvements reducing operational costs and increasing system efficiency.

Industry-Specific Drivers

  • Manufacturing Automation: Rising labor costs incentivize automation, with waterjet cutting offering high precision and minimal material waste.
  • Material Versatility: Waterjet systems can cut a wide array of materials—metals, composites, glass, ceramics—driving demand across diverse sectors.
  • Environmental Regulations: Waterjet technology’s eco-friendly profile, with no hazardous chemicals or fumes, aligns with stricter environmental standards.

Value Chain and Revenue Models

The value chain encompasses:

  1. Raw Material Sourcing: Procurement of garnet abrasives, high-pressure pumps, and cutting heads, often sourced globally from regions like Australia, India, and China.
  2. Manufacturing: Assembly of core components, integration of CNC controls, and system calibration, primarily in South Korea by local and multinational players.
  3. Distribution & Sales: Direct OEM channels, regional distributors, and online platforms facilitate market reach.
  4. End-User Delivery & Lifecycle Services: Installation, training, maintenance, and upgrades form the recurring revenue streams, with lifecycle services accounting for approximately 20-25% of total revenue.

Revenue models include:

  • Initial system sales (capex-based)
  • Consumables and spare parts (recurring)
  • Service contracts and system upgrades
  • Digital solutions and system monitoring subscriptions

Cost Structures, Pricing Strategies, and Risk Factors

Key cost components include:

  • High-pressure pump systems (~40%)
  • Control systems and software (~20%)
  • Abrasives and consumables (~15%)
  • Labor, R&D, and overhead (~15%)
  • Distribution and after-sales (~10%)

Pricing strategies focus on value-based pricing, emphasizing system precision, reliability, and after-sales support. Capital investments are typically high, with systems costing between USD 100,000 to USD 500,000 depending on capacity and features. Operating margins are influenced by consumable sales and service contracts.

Major risk factors include:

  • Regulatory challenges related to environmental standards and export controls
  • Cybersecurity threats targeting connected systems
  • Market saturation and commoditization of basic systems
  • Supply chain disruptions affecting raw material availability

Adoption Trends and End-User Insights

In South Korea, key end-user segments demonstrate distinct adoption patterns:

  • Aerospace & Defense: High-precision, complex cuts; demand driven by national aerospace initiatives and export markets.
  • Automotive: Use of waterjets for cutting composites and metals; focus on lightweight, high-strength materials.
  • Electronics & Semiconductor: Micro-cutting applications requiring micron-level accuracy.
  • Construction & Art: Custom fabrication, sculptures, and architectural elements.

Shifting consumption patterns include increased adoption of automated, IoT-enabled systems, and a trend toward in-house manufacturing capabilities to reduce dependency on external suppliers.
